About This Book

"Eye-catching – appealingly told" - School Library Journal

Sam knew he couldn't have a real dog of his own, but his mum drew him a picture - a 'Doodle' she called it - of a beautiful black and white puppy.
Sam took it bed with him that night. The next morning he was woken by a strange tickly feeling on his cheek.
Even before he opened his eyes he knew it was 'Doodle Dog'.

"The power of a child's imagination to make a mere picture of a longed-for pet come alive is given form in Rodgers' lively drawings that convey both boy and pet's joy in each other." - Book List
